The Tang Dynasty was one of the most glorious periods in Chinese history, yet this powerful empire ultimately perished. Many people blame Emperor Xuanzong of Tang for the downfall of the dynasty. So, was the demise of the Tang Dynasty really due to Emperor Xuanzong? This article will analyze the issue from two aspects: historical background and Emperor Xuanzong's policies.
Firstly, the reasons for the Tang Dynasty's downfall were multifaceted, including political, economic, military, and ethnic conflicts. In the later stages of the dynasty, political corruption was severe, and the bureaucratic system became rigid, leading to a decline in national governance capabilities. Additionally, the impact of the An-Shi Rebellion worsened the country's financial situation, causing widespread suffering among the people. Moreover, continuous border wars and escalating ethnic conflicts added to the internal strife within the country. Therefore, it is inappropriate to simply blame Emperor Xuanzong alone for the Tang Dynasty's demise.
Secondly, Emperor Xuanzong was an outstanding emperor of the Tang Dynasty who implemented a series of reform measures during his reign, resulting in political stability and economic prosperity. However, in his later years, he made some serious mistakes. Firstly, he placed too much trust in eunuchs, leading to their gradual growth in power and ultimately the outbreak of the An-Shi Rebellion. Secondly, he became indulgent in pleasures and neglected government affairs in his later reign, exacerbating political corruption. Lastly, he adopted a passive approach to border issues, resulting in continuous border wars.
In conclusion, the reasons for the Tang Dynasty's downfall were multifaceted, and Emperor Xuanzong's faulty policies and decisions indeed contributed to the decline of the country. However, we cannot overlook the impact of other historical backgrounds and factors on the dynasty's demise. Therefore, when analyzing the reasons for the Tang Dynasty's downfall, we should comprehensively consider various factors rather than simply blaming it on one individual.
